Understanding Copywriting vs. Content Writing

At first glance, the terms copywriting and content writing may seem interchangeable; however, they serve different purposes and utilize different strategies:

  • Copywriting: This involves writing persuasive text that motivates the reader to take a specific action, typically in the context of advertisements, sales pages, and promotional content.
  • Content Writing: In contrast, content writing focuses on creating informational and engaging material to convey knowledge, with the aim of providing value to the reader rather than direct sales.

The Role of Copywriting in Business

Copywriting is a powerful tool in every marketer's arsenal. It is designed not just to inform, but to persuade. Here's how effective copywriting can propel your business forward:

1. Building Brand Identity

Through concise and impactful language, copywriting helps you communicate your brand's personality. Your choice of words can evoke emotions, leading your audience to associate those feelings with your brand. A well-crafted tagline or slogan can become memorable and synonymous with your business.

2. Driving Conversions

Every piece of copy you produce should have a clear call to action (CTA). Whether it’s encouraging a visitor to sign up for a newsletter or purchase a product, copywriting needs to lead the reader to make a decision. A/B testing different versions of your copy can yield insights into what resonates best with your audience, optimizing conversion rates.

3. Enhancing SEO and Online Visibility

Good copywriting is also aligned with search engine optimization (SEO) practices. Incorporating relevant keywords naturally into your text—such as "copywriting and content writing"—can improve your website's ranking on search engines, drawing organic traffic and broadening your audience base.

The Significance of Content Writing

Content writing, while distinct from copywriting, plays an equally vital role in building your business's online presence. Here’s why:

1. Providing Value and Expertise

Well-researched articles, blog posts, and guides position your business as an authority in your niche. By sharing useful information, you not only attract visitors but also foster trust and credibility, essential elements for long-term customer relationships.

2. Engaging the Audience

With the right content strategy, you can tailor articles and posts to address the interests and pain points of your audience, increasing engagement. Whether it’s through storytelling, humor, or relatable experiences, engaging content encourages readers to spend more time on your site and share it with others.

3. Supporting Social Media Strategy

Content writing is crucial for effective social media marketing. High-quality content can be shared across platforms, creating buzz and driving traffic back to your site. It's an effective way to continuously engage with your audience, providing them with regular insights and updates.

Integrating Copywriting and Content Writing in Marketing Strategies

To maximize the benefits of copywriting and content writing, businesses should integrate both into their overall marketing strategies. Here’s how to do this effectively:

1. Define Your Target Audience

The first step in crafting effective copy and content is understanding who your audience is. Employ tools like customer personas and audience analysis to gather insights into their preferences, needs, and challenges. This information is invaluable when creating targeted messaging that resonates.

2. Craft a Compelling Brand Story

Your brand story is the narrative that encapsulates who you are as a business. It should communicate your mission, values, and the unique selling proposition (USP) that sets you apart from your competitors. Both your copy and content should reflect this narrative consistently.

3. Develop a Content Calendar

Strategic planning is key. A content calendar helps you organize your writing efforts, ensuring a balanced mix of both promotional (copywriting) and informative (content writing) materials. Consistency keeps your audience engaged and builds expectations for what’s to come.

4. Optimize for SEO

Integrate relevant keywords throughout your text. Utilize tools for keyword research to find terms your target audience is searching for and create content that satisfies those queries. This helps improve organic reach and enhances your site's visibility.

5. Measure and Analyze Performance

Utilize analytics tools to track the performance of your copy and content. Monitor metrics such as bounce rate, time on page, and conversion rates. This data allows you to make informed adjustments to your strategies, improving overall effectiveness.
